Charlotte Healy, the Bristol City manager focused on her first season and ambitions for promotion to WSL 2. She discusses rebuilding the club and the impact of new ownership. Tanya Oxtoby, the newly appointed Newcastle manager, shares her vision for the club's future and insights on squad management. Both leaders emphasize the importance of a high-performance culture and player development. Tanya even reveals how 'pigs in blankets' have become a fun team tradition during their preparations!

Man City Emerged As Early Title Pace-Setters

  • Manchester City have surprised experts by starting the season strongest under new manager Andre Jurglitz.
  • Emma Sanders and the panel consider City the best team so far despite pre-season doubts about their depth.

Chelsea's Depth Still Favors A Comeback

  • Sonia Bompastor's rotation approach previously masked Chelsea issues but the squad still has elite depth.
  • Jen Beattie and others expect Chelsea to recover because they can absorb injuries better than many rivals.

Tottenham Are The Season's Surprise Package

  • Tottenham have exceeded expectations by becoming more compact and resilient under their new manager.
  • The panel highlighted the 3-3 draw with Manchester United as a sign of Tottenham's improved competitiveness.
